Perfume and Fashion are synonymous; fashion complements perfume, and perfume complements fragrance. While some people would think that perfume is not as important as the outfit you are wearing, I would argue that fragrance is just as important.

Fragrance, arguably, elevates one’s outfit. Fragrance throughout history has gone through many evolutions and phases but one thing is certain — fragrances have always been used to create a story behind one’s persona and presentation. Whether you use a fruity, youthful scent for the summer, or a sophisticated fragrance to complement your entrance to a high society gala, fragrances are important accessories.

Fragrances carry different meanings in society and the art of choosing a fragrance is not black-and-white, but there are some fragrances that historically and timelessly match the vibe you are going for. For a pool party in August, for example, one would tend to gravitate towards a coconut, light, fruity scent. This scent would match well with a bathing suit, long flowy skirt, denim shorts, and a bright top. These scents encapsulate an aura of playfulness, fun and overall soaking in the sun.

For an early spring picnic in a flower field, one would tend to go for a floral, light, airy, and clean scent. I would imagine individuals wearing sun hats, light cable knit sweaters, long denim skirts, flowy tops, white sneakers, and gingham print clothing articles. I imagine this scent complementing the air around you, or, if you are not in a picnic, encapsulating the scents of early spring. I imagine individuals would want to use this scent to welcome spring, and escape a long winter. Furthermore, I would imagine these scents to be less strong than summer, and be delicate, subtle scents.

For another scenario, I imagine a scent for a warm, cozy winter night. Scents that complement this situation would be cashmere, pine, vanilla, toasted marshmallow, and sandalwood. Outfits that would be worn in this situation include oversized sweatshirts, sweatpants, colorful fuzzy socks, UGG slippers, oversized hoodies, warm fuzzy blankets, and pajama bottoms.
